A taper gauge set consists of a series of thin, flat metal strips, each possessing a precisely defined taper. Typically made from high-quality steel or stainless steel, these gauges come in various sizes and tapers to accommodate different measurement needs . The primary purpose of a taper gauge is to measure the depth, width, or angle of narrow spaces or tapered sections that other tools might struggle to assess accurately. One of the primary applications of taper gauge sets is in the field of machining and fabrication. When manufacturing components that require specific angles or depth, such as molds, dies, or complex mechanical parts, professionals rely on taper gauges to ensure that their measurements are both accurate and consistent. Taper gauges allow machinists to quickly evaluate whether a workpiece meets the required specifications, thereby reducing the risk of errors that could lead to costly rework or material waste. taper gauge set Another important application of taper gauges is in quality control processes. In industries such as aerospace, automotive, and even construction, maintaining high standards is crucial. Taper gauges provide inspectors with a reliable means to assess the taper of holes or fittings, ensuring that components fit together as intended. Understanding Liquid Check Valves Function and Importance Liquid check valves, also known as non-return valves or one-way valves, are crucial components in various fluid handling systems. Their primary function is to allow the flow of liquid in one direction while preventing backflow. This feature is particularly important in systems where maintaining a controlled flow is vital for operational efficiency and safety. Check valves operate based on pressure differential. When liquid flows through the valve in the intended direction, the internal mechanism allows the valve to open, facilitating smooth flow. However, if there is any attempt for fluid to flow backward, the valve closes automatically, preventing any reverse movement. This automatic operation is pivotal in preventing potential damage to pumps and other equipment that could result from backflow. These valves come in various designs, including swing check valves, lift check valves, and ball check valves, each serving different applications based on their specific mechanical functions. For instance, swing check valves utilize a hinged disc that swings open and closed, while ball check valves use a ball mechanism that will seat to block backflow when flow reverses. The choice of valve depends on the system's requirements, including the type of liquid being transported, pressure and temperature conditions, and installation orientation. liquid check valve One of the critical advantages of liquid check valves is their role in enhancing system reliability . By preventing backflow, they help maintain the proper operation of pumps and ensure that pipelines do not become contaminated by reverse flow. This is especially important in applications like water treatment plants, chemical processing facilities, and hydraulic systems, where preventing contamination and maintaining flow integrity are essential.
